Subject: FD-leak hunt cut-over — done

Hey,

The cut-over to the new Gullwing descriptor tracker went smoothly last night. The old polling hack is gone; we now hook close() paths directly and the leak counter on the Thornbeck dashboard finally reads zero. Two stragglers in the archive worker got patched along the way — worth a look in your review. The tracker runs with the config below.

deployment values, kajef-fahip:
druwyn:
  pin: 0722
  metrics_host: metrics.druwyn.zemvarsys.internal
  tenant: juldor
  seal: seal_6ddf1794

- [ ] Step 7: Archive cold storage buckets (Glacierline tier). Confirm both ceremony witnesses are present, verify bucket manifests match the Oxbow ledger, then seal the archive key shares. Plugin authors may observe but not handle shares. Once sealed, the archive index itself is encrypted and can only be reopened with the passphrase below.

vault phrase of badup-hahig = tamael-aldael-kelmir-istael-fenok-istwyn-tamius-jorath-oliion

**14:22** — Support escalations confirmed that the Merrivale dedupe job had merged unrelated customer records sharing a normalized postal code. We paused the pipeline, restored the pre-merge snapshot, and re-ran matching with the stricter name-similarity threshold. Affected accounts were flagged for manual review. The corrected batch shipped under the trace token recorded below.

session token of tajef-bageg = htk21_5d90d574934f3ccae6437